Alright had hot rod cams installed on my 06 automatic and got a remote tune.Yesterday when driving around my neighborhood my over drive light started flashing . Read the codes and its p0745, p0732, p0733, the first is a solenoid, the others are incorrect ratio?My tuner says the transmission detected a slip and its not the tune, its never thrown codes until the tune was put on.

Car has 70k miles, tranny fluid changed at 30k and 62k miles, never been raced and I rarely get on it, only occasionally.When driving it shifts smooth and firmly, revs do not jump and I haven't felt it slip.Any ideas? Is it tune related and what could be the fix?
